transmission problem

i have a 97 f-150 lariat 2 wheel drive. started it this morning backed out of the driveway and put in drive. slow to move foreward but it got going and shifted gears. drove about a mile and that was it. engine reves but truck will not move in any gear. truck has 103000 miles on it.i changed trans fluid and filter when i bought it at 95000.anyone have any idea what the problem could be?

You have the 4R100 TRANS. I would look at the wiring first since it's cheaper than a trans. Make sure it isn't messed up anywhere. Mine slipped from the line and you have pretty close to the same trans I have. Fixed mine w/transgo shift kit - under $100 @ troyer w/f150 online discount. I also added Amsoil. Trans is great now w/over 230,000 miles on it..
